Qatar Airways Flight #QR646 Looped 27 Times Over Kathmandu Due to Bad Weather

Qatar Airways’ flight #QR646, operating from Doha to Kathmandu (Nepal) with a Boeing B787-9 registered as A7-BHK, was unable to land at Kathmandu due to adverse weather conditions. The pilots had to hold over Kathmandu for approximately three hours, completing a total of 27 loops.

As weather conditions did not improve and the aircraft reached minimum fuel levels, the pilots diverted to Kolkata, India.

According to Flightradar24 data, this flight became the most tracked flight worldwide today. Additionally, it was recorded as one of the two flights with the highest number of loops in aviation history.
